A BILL
To protect the second amendment rights of individuals to carry
firearms in units of the National Park System,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the `National Park Second Amendment
Restoration and Personal Protection Act of 2007'.
SEC. 2. FINDINGS.
Congress finds that--
(1) the second amendment to the Constitution provides
that `the right of the people to keep and bear Arms, shall not be
infringed';
(2) section 2.4(a)(1) of title 36, Code of Federal
Regulations, provides that `except as otherwise provided in this
section and parts 7 (special regulations) and 13 (Alaska
regulations), the following are prohibited: (i) Possessing a weapon,
trap or net (ii) Carrying a weapon, trap or net (iii) Using a weapon,
trap or net';
(3) the regulations described in paragraph (2) prevent
individuals complying with Federal and State laws from exercising the
second amendment rights of the individuals while at units of the
National Park System;
(4) the existence of different laws relating to the
transportation and possession of firearms at different units of the
National Park System entraps law-abiding gun owners while at units of
the National Park System; and
(5) the Federal laws should make it clear that the second
amendment rights of an individual at a unit of the National Park
System should not be infringed.
SEC. 3. FIREARMS IN UNITS OF THE NATIONAL PARK SYSTEM.
No Federal regulation shall restrict any individual from
possessing or carrying a firearm if that restriction is based in
whole or in part upon the fact that the individual is in a unit of
the National Park System.

Soon after prosecutor Michael Nifong was disbarred by the North Carolina Bar Association, the National District Attorneys Association issued its take on the case. “Nifong’s case is rarer than human rabies,” claimed Joshua Marquis, vice president of the group. “The defense bar is piling on and trying to claim this is typical behavior,” he bitterly complained.
So was Michael Nifong merely a “rogue” prosecutor, a feckless bad-apple amidst a scented orchard of ethical and civic-minded district attorneys?
You may remember the 1989 rape of the Central Park jogger and the accusation that five “wilding” teenagers had perpetrated the attack. But when the DNA test results did not match, the prosecutor had to claim the semen came from a sixth “mystery” member of the gang. Despite that dubious explanation, the five were convicted.
But 13 years later DNA evidence proved another man had committed the crime and the five were set free. Sorry about that, fellas.
Twenty-five years ago civil rights attorneys Barry Scheck and Peter Neufeld established the Innocence Project, a group dedicated to protecting the innocent through post-conviction DNA testing. Earlier this month the group registered its 205th exoneration, most of the cases involving false convictions of rape. Prosecutorial misconduct is a factor in 42% of DNA exonerations, they reveal. [Read]
Child sexual abuse is another charge that juices up any prosecutor with political aspirations.
In 1994, the small town of Wenatchee, Wash. was seized by a wave of sex abuse hysteria. Parents and Sunday school teachers were accused of child rape. Over two years, 43 adults were arrested on 29,726 charges of sex abuse involving 60 children. [Read]
Not a scrap of physical evidence was presented to support the charges and some witnesses later recanted their testimony. But that didn’t keep 17 of the accused from going to jail. ...

Judge Orders Government to Pay $101.75M for Wrongful Convictions in 1965 Murder Case
the FBI considered the four "collateral damage" in its war against the Mafia, the bureau's top priority in the 1960s.
------
Judge Orders Government to Pay $101.75M for Wrongful Convictions in 1965 Murder Case
Thursday, July 26, 2007
E-MAIL STORY PRINTER FRIENDLY VERSION
BOSTON — In a stinging rebuke of the FBI, a federal judge on Thursday ordered the government to pay a record judgment of nearly $102 million because agents withheld evidence that would have kept four men from spending decades in prison for a mob murder they did not commit.
Judge Nancy Gertner told a packed courtroom that agents were trying to protect informants when they encouraged a witness to lie, then withheld evidence they knew could prove the four men were not involved in the 1965 murder of Edward "Teddy" Deegan, a small-time thug shot in an alley.
Click here for FOXNews.com's Crime center.
Gertner said Boston FBI agents knew mob hitman Joseph "The Animal" Barboza lied when he named Joseph Salvati, Peter Limone, Henry Tameleo and Louis Greco as Deegan's killers. She said the FBI considered the four "collateral damage" in its war against the Mafia, the bureau's top priority in the 1960s.
Tameleo and Greco died behind bars, and Salvati and Limone spent three decades in prison before they were exonerated in 2001. Salvati, Limone and the families of the other men sued the federal government for malicious prosecution.
...Gertner said FBI agents Dennis Condon and H. Paul Rico not only withheld evidence of Barboza's lie, but told state prosecutors who were handling the Deegan murder investigation that they had checked out Barboza's story and it was true.
"The FBI's misconduct was clearly the sole cause of this conviction," the judge said.
The government had argued federal authorities had no duty to share information with state officials who prosecuted the men. Federal authorities cannot be held responsible for the results of a state prosecution, a Justice Department lawyer said.
Gertner rejected that argument.
"The government's position is, in a word, absurd," she said.
